US IPO Weekly Recap: Virgin America flies high as IPO market reaches 250 with 9 new offerings
9 companies went public this week, raising $2 billion in the IPO market as year-to-date issuance surpassed 250 IPOs, almost 25% more than at this point last year. 3 large PE-backed deals, including two LBOs, each traded up over 10% and represented 79% of proceeds, while the 4 smallest companies by market cap had the lowest returns. Axalta Coating Systems scheduled to enter the Renaissance IPO ETF (IPO)
Axalta Coating Systems (AXTA), a leading global supplier of coatings for the auto and transportation industry, raised $975 million by offering 50 million shares at $19.50 a share. At the pricing terms, Axalta commands a market value of $4.7 billion and qualifies for inclusion in the Renaissance IPO ETF at the market's close on November 18, 2014. A shiny finish for the auto paint IPO: Axalta Coating prices upsized $975 million IPO at midpoint
Axalta Coating Systems, a leading global supplier of coatings for the auto and transportation industry, raised $975 million by offering 50 million shares at $19.50, the midpoint of the $18 to $21 range.
